About Dormant Bare-Root Vines:

Dormant bare-root vines are planted and grown in a nursery field during the whole growing season, then dug out in fall-winter after the vines have entered dormancy. After being graded they are stored in cold storage until delivery. Dormant vines are produced at standard size (12-inch rootstock).

When to plant?

  • Typically, the ideal planting season for dormant vines spans from March to June. However, winter planting is also an option, albeit less common.
  • Keep in mind that dormant vines usually require some acclimation before planting, and their roots may need to be trimmed, as they are usually delivered with 6-inch-long roots. Don't hesitate to reach out to us for our planting guidelines.

What are the advantages of dormant bare-root vines?

  • Dormant vines are generally more robust than potted vines because they were grown for a full season in a field.
  • They can be planted earlier in the season, which allows stronger growth the year of planting.
  • They are easier to ship and handle than potted vines, also easier to plant.
